Printouts have vertical streaks

Cause: The paper type is not suitable for the HP All-in-One.

Solution: If the paper you are using is too fibrous, the ink applied by the HP All-in- One might not fully cover the surface of the paper. Use HP Premium Papers or any other paper type that is appropriate for the HP All-in-One.

Printouts are slanted or skewed

Cause: The paper is not feeding properly or is loaded incorrectly.

Solution: Make sure the paper is loaded correctly.

Cause: More than one type of paper is loaded in the input tray.

Solution: Load only one type of paper at a time.

Cause: The rear door might not be securely installed.

Solution: Make sure the rear door is securely installed.

Paper is not picked up from the input tray

Cause: There is not enough paper in the input tray.

Solution: If the HP All-in-One is out of paper or there are only a few sheets remaining, load more paper in the input tray. If there is paper in the input tray, remove the paper, tap the stack of paper against a flat surface, and reload the paper into the input tray. To continue your print job, press Start Copy Black on the control panel of the HP All-in-One.
